From an analyst’s perspective:

Valaris Ltd [NYSE: VAL] stock has seen the most recent analyst activity on January 15, 2025, when Evercore ISI downgraded its rating to a In-line and also revised its price target to $59 from $87. Previously, Barclays downgraded its rating to Equal Weight on December 18, 2024, and dropped its price target to $49. On December 09, 2024, downgrade downgraded it’s rating to Neutral and revised its price target to $47 on the stock. JP Morgan started tracking the stock assigning a Underweight rating and suggested a price target of $40 on December 06, 2024. The Benchmark Company downgraded its rating to a Hold. Susquehanna started tracking with a Neutral rating for this stock on September 24, 2024, and assigned it a price target of $62. In a note dated July 16, 2024, Pickering Energy Partners downgraded an Neutral rating on this stock.
